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Reviewed: 17 November 2023
Ben
United KingdomA few more utensils in the kitchen and maybe some extra standard stuff like salt and sugar etc (we got some from the restaurant bit, who were lovely). The downstairs was lovely and decorated very well. The upstairs was fine but felt a little like it wasn't quite the same standard as downstairs, maybe thinking it would just be kids staying there.
Obviously the location and spa is the main draw here, it's amazing. The restaurant was fine, not a huge menu but we self catered for most of our meals. The house we stayed in (The Clubhouse) was nice, fitting 4 adults and 1 child very comfortably.

Reviewed: 4 August 2023
Jaan
United Statesi have been to iceland a few times now. on this trip we were multi-generational; grandparents, parents, and children. just wonderful accommodations. the food and springs were awesome. perfect location. easy for people to split off for the day and do activities, then meet back and enjoy the kitchen for meals. my son ( 10) particularly enjoyed fly fishing in the lake. the spa rivals the blue lagoon- more authentic and less touristy feel.

Reviewed: 20 August 2022
Chaitan
United Statesour biggest issue with the property was that the geothermal pools shown in the picture were actually not included with the property. one of the main reasons we booked this property was because we wanted to get away from the crowded geothermal pools to have something that the family could enjoy more privately. But once we arrived, first of all, it was very hard to find the geothermal tools on the property. Then when we found it after driving around on difficult potholed roads, it was completely cold and non-functional and we ended up leaving without using the pool. When we called the property and asked them to investigate, they told us they will get back to us but never did. The pool that is shown in the picture, we enquired where it was and then they told us that it is no longer included in the property and you have to pay ~$50 per adult in order to access this. that is basically misrepresentation of what is included in the property. Some of the supplies were very stingy. They did not even have enough plastic bags to put trash away. They had two plastic bags into trash cans and when we asked for more, they never responded; so we ended up finding bags throughout the house or going out ourselves to get some in order to throw the trash away for the three nights we were there. In the end, we don't think this property is worth what they are charging for it. Primarily because of the geothermal pools, at least in our opinion. We would not stay there again even if we were to go back to Iceland. Too overpriced and not enough value for the money
We traveled to this estate with the family, two small kids, + me and my wife and we stayed there for three nights. This was part of a 13 day trip around Iceland. The location of the estate is absolutely beautiful. The house was clean when we entered and all the equipment was in good working order. They had coffee, tea available so we did not have to go by basic necessities and also provided some detergent as well as washing fluids and soaps and shampoos.
